数据库制作都需要什么工具

worktile 其他 4

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库制作通常需要以下几种工具:

    1. 数据库管理系统(Database Management System,简称DBMS):DBMS是数据库的核心组件,用于管理和操作数据库。常见的DBMS包括MySQL、Oracle、Microsoft SQL Server等。选择合适的DBMS取决于项目需求、预算以及技术要求。

    2. 数据建模工具:数据建模工具用于设计数据库结构和关系。它可以帮助开发人员创建实体-关系图(Entity-Relationship Diagram,简称ERD)来表示实体、属性和关系。常见的数据建模工具有ERwin、PowerDesigner、MySQL Workbench等。

    3. 数据库设计工具:数据库设计工具用于创建和管理数据库对象,如表、索引、视图等。它可以提供直观的界面来定义数据库结构,并生成相应的SQL脚本。常见的数据库设计工具有Navicat、Toad、SQL Server Management Studio等。

    4. 数据导入和导出工具:数据导入和导出工具用于将数据从一个数据库导入到另一个数据库,或将数据库中的数据导出为文件。这些工具通常支持不同的数据格式和数据库类型,并提供灵活的映射和转换功能。常见的数据导入和导出工具有DataGrip、DBeaver、Oracle Data Pump等。

    5. 数据库性能监测工具:数据库性能监测工具用于监测和分析数据库的性能指标,如响应时间、并发连接数、缓存命中率等。这些工具可以帮助开发人员优化数据库性能,并提供实时的性能报告和警报。常见的数据库性能监测工具有SQL Server Profiler、MySQL Enterprise Monitor、Oracle Enterprise Manager等。

    除了以上提到的工具,还有一些辅助工具如版本控制工具(如Git)、文档生成工具(如Doxygen)等,可以在数据库开发和维护过程中提供便利。根据具体的项目需求和团队技术栈,可能还需要其他特定的工具。因此,选择适合自己需求的工具是数据库制作的关键。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在进行数据库制作时,需要使用一些工具来辅助完成任务。以下是常用的数据库制作工具:

    1. 数据库管理系统(DBMS):数据库管理系统是数据库的核心组成部分,用于管理和操作数据库。常见的DBMS包括Oracle、MySQL、Microsoft SQL Server等。选择适合自己需求的DBMS是数据库制作的第一步。

    2. 数据建模工具:数据建模工具用于设计数据库的结构和关系模型。常见的数据建模工具包括ERwin、PowerDesigner、MySQL Workbench等。通过数据建模工具,可以创建实体、属性、关系等数据库对象,进而构建数据库结构。

    3. SQL开发工具:SQL开发工具用于编写、执行和调试SQL语句。常见的SQL开发工具包括PL/SQL Developer、Toad、Navicat等。通过SQL开发工具,可以方便地进行数据查询、数据导入导出、存储过程编写等操作。

    4. 数据库设计工具:数据库设计工具用于可视化设计数据库表结构、字段、关联等。常见的数据库设计工具包括DB Designer、Navicat Data Modeler等。通过数据库设计工具,可以快速创建和修改数据库表结构,提高开发效率。

    5. 数据库备份和恢复工具:数据库备份和恢复工具用于定期备份和恢复数据库,以保证数据的安全性和可靠性。常见的数据库备份和恢复工具包括Oracle Recovery Manager(RMAN)、MySQL Dump等。通过备份和恢复工具,可以避免因意外故障而导致的数据丢失。

    6. 数据库性能监控工具:数据库性能监控工具用于实时监控数据库的性能指标,如CPU利用率、内存使用率、磁盘IO等。常见的数据库性能监控工具包括Oracle Enterprise Manager、MySQL Enterprise Monitor等。通过性能监控工具,可以及时发现和解决数据库性能问题,提升系统的稳定性和响应速度。

    总结来说,数据库制作需要使用数据库管理系统、数据建模工具、SQL开发工具、数据库设计工具、数据库备份和恢复工具以及数据库性能监控工具等工具来完成各个环节的任务。这些工具的选择和使用将对数据库的设计、开发和维护产生重要影响。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在进行数据库制作时,需要使用以下工具:

    1. 数据库管理系统(DBMS):数据库管理系统是一种软件,用于创建和管理数据库。常见的数据库管理系统包括MySQL、Oracle、SQL Server等。选择合适的数据库管理系统取决于项目的需求和特定的技术要求。

    2. 数据建模工具:数据建模工具用于设计和绘制数据库的逻辑模型。通过这些工具,可以创建实体、属性和关系,并定义它们之间的联系。常用的数据建模工具有PowerDesigner、ERwin、MySQL Workbench等。

    3. SQL编辑器:SQL编辑器用于编写和执行SQL语句。通过SQL编辑器,可以创建和修改数据库对象,执行查询和更新操作,以及管理数据库的安全性和权限。常用的SQL编辑器有Navicat、DBeaver、Toad等。

    4. 数据库备份和恢复工具:数据库备份和恢复工具用于创建数据库的备份,并在需要时恢复数据库。这些工具可以保护数据库免受数据损坏、硬件故障或其他灾难性事件的影响。常见的数据库备份和恢复工具有MySQLdump、Oracle RMAN、SQL Server Backup等。

    5. 数据库性能优化工具:数据库性能优化工具用于分析和改进数据库的性能。这些工具可以识别潜在的性能瓶颈,并提供优化建议。常见的数据库性能优化工具有MySQL Performance Tuning Primer、Oracle SQL Tuning Advisor、SQL Server Query Store等。

    6. 数据库监控工具:数据库监控工具用于实时监控数据库的运行状态和性能指标。通过这些工具,可以检测数据库的负载情况、查询性能和资源利用率,并及时采取措施进行优化。常用的数据库监控工具有Nagios、Zabbix、Prometheus等。

    7. 数据库版本控制工具:数据库版本控制工具用于管理和跟踪数据库的变更。它们可以记录数据库对象的修改历史,提供版本比较和合并功能,并支持团队协作和并行开发。常见的数据库版本控制工具有Git、SVN、Mercurial等。

    除了上述工具,还需要掌握数据库设计和管理的相关知识,如数据建模、数据库范式、索引优化、查询调优等。此外,还需要熟悉操作系统和网络的基本知识,以便正确安装和配置数据库软件,并保证数据库的稳定运行。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部